Given basic nutritional information, the daily values are set for a diet of 2000 calories.
The daily values represent the appropriate intake levels for a 2000 calorie diet. This is not to say that every person should have a 2000 calorie intake daily, but it is used by the USDA to establish a benchmark to be used.
For example, a person who has a daily calorie intake of 2000 calories should, according to the USDA, consume about 50 grams of protein per day. These numbers can then be adjusted proportionally for each individual based on their calorie intake.

The lungs are not equal in size. The right lung is shorter, because the liver sits high, tucked under the rib cage, but it is broader/wider than the left. Each lung is separated into lobes branching off the main bronchus the right lung has three lobes, while the left has only two lobes. That's why the left lung and the right lung are difference.
